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area

 

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area is located approximately 17 miles west of the Las Vegas Strip on Charleston Blvd (State Route 159).  Go west on Charleston and a short distance after you cross Town Center Dr. and just before you cross over the 215 (Las Vegas Beltway) on your right you will see a Best Buy store, Burger King, Terrible Herbst Chevron Gas Station.  Behind all of this and barely visible is a Costco, (everyone needs a Costco) and to your left is the Red Rock Casino.   Continuing west on Charleston Blvd. for approximately another 5.25 miles, on your right you will see the entrance to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area.
Park Hours:  The park is generally open from 6:00 am until dusk.  The visitor center is open from approximately 8:00 am to 4:30 pm depending on the time of the year. (702) 515-5350
The loop road is a 13.1 mile paved one-way only road (see map below).  Vehicles must stay on the designated roads and there is no off-roading allowed while on the scenic loop drive.

There are four "Public Rock Art" sites located in Red Rock Canyon.

Site 1:  Calico Hills 2 Overlook Petroglyph Site

Calico Hills 2 Overlook Petroglyphs:  Park at the Calico Hills 2 Overlook.  Take the trail towards the Sand Quarry.  In a short distance where the trail forks, take the left (upper) trail.  The distance from the parking area to the marked BLM petroglyph site is approximately 1/2 mile.
Coordinates for the two rocks at this site:  36° 09.374'    115° 26.389'

 

Willow Springs Picnic Area

The Willow Springs Picnic Area has several trails, including the Lost Creek - Children's Discovery Trail.  Along with the trails, the area has archaeological sites which include pictographs, petroglyphs, and a roasting pit or two - all of which can be easily accessed.
Site 2:  The "Hand Prints" pictographs are located to the rear of the one group of picnic benches. Coordinates for pictographs:  36° 09.615'    115° 29.845'

 

 Site 3:  The trail to the "Petroglyph Wall" starts at the west end of the second parking area, and is fairly well marked with stones.  The trail goes across the wash to the adjacent cliffs.

Petroglyph Wall and the trail.  Coordinates for the "Wall" 36° 09.657'    115° 30.048'

 

Site 4:  Children's Discovery Trail Pictographs are located about half way around the loop.  Coordinates for the pictographs: 36° 09.395    115° 29.821.  No photos available at this time.
